Why Luxembourg Embraces Rooftop Solar Solutions

As one of Europe's wealthiest nations, Luxembourg faces unique energy challenges. Limited land availability makes rooftop installations particularly attractive. Consider these compelling factors:

  • Space optimization: 87% of suitable solar surfaces are rooftops in urban areas (Luxembourg Institute of Science and Technology, 2023)
  • Energy independence: Residential solar systems can offset 60-80% of household electricity needs
  • Government support: 20% tax credit + €500/kW installation grant (effective until 2025)

"Luxembourg aims to generate 25% of its energy from renewables by 2030. Rooftop photovoltaics will play a pivotal role in achieving this target." - Ministry of Energy

Installation Cost Breakdown (Typical 5kW System)

Component Cost (€) Percentage
Panels 4,200 42%
Inverter 1,100 11%
Installation 3,500 35%
Miscellaneous 1,200 12%

3-Step Implementation Process

Wondering how to start your solar journey? Here's the streamlined approach used by local experts:

  1. Site Assessment: Roof orientation analysis using LiDAR mapping
  2. System Design: Custom configurations for maximum yield
  3. Grid Connection: Certified integration with national power network

Pro tip: South-facing roofs with 10-30° tilt angles deliver optimal performance. But don't worry - east-west configurations can still achieve 85% efficiency!

Navigating Regulations Made Simple

While the process is straightforward, compliance matters. Key requirements include:

  • Maximum system height: 30cm above roof surface
  • Heritage zone exceptions: Special permits for protected buildings
  • Grid connection: Mandatory certification by Lux-Energie

Frequently Asked Questions

  • Q: How long do panels last in Luxembourg's climate? A: 25-30 years with proper maintenance - snowfall has minimal impact
  • Q: Can I sell excess energy back to the grid? A: Yes! Current buyback rates stand at €0.18/kWh
  • Q: What maintenance is required? A: Annual inspections + occasional cleaning (twice yearly recommended)
